Ajay Kumar Gupta wrote:
> Added USB host and device config for host (MSC, Keyboard) and
> device (ACM) functionalities.
> 

I will add this to the omap usb patch set.
Thanks
Tom

> Signed-off-by: Ajay Kumar Gupta <ajay.gupta@ti.com>
> ---
> This patch is intended to be applied on top of recent OMAP3 musb
> patches from Tom Rix.
> 
>  include/configs/omap3_evm.h |   39 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
>  1 files changed, 39 insertions(+), 0 deletions(-)
> 
> diff --git a/include/configs/omap3_evm.h b/include/configs/omap3_evm.h
> index a5514ae..cbefbb1 100644
> --- a/include/configs/omap3_evm.h
> +++ b/include/configs/omap3_evm.h
> @@ -101,6 +101,44 @@
>  #define CONFIG_OMAP3_MMC		1
>  #define CONFIG_DOS_PARTITION		1
>  
> +/* USB
> + * Enable CONFIG_MUSB_HCD for Host functionalities MSC, keyboard
> + * Enable CONFIG_MUSB_UDD for Device functionalities.
> + */
> +#define CONFIG_USB_OMAP3		1
> +#define CONFIG_MUSB_HCD			1
> +/* #define CONFIG_MUSB_UDC		1 */
> +
> +#ifdef CONFIG_USB_OMAP3
> +
> +#ifdef CONFIG_MUSB_HCD
> +#define CONFIG_CMD_USB
> +
> +#define CONFIG_USB_STORAGE
> +#define CONGIG_CMD_STORAGE
> +#define CONFIG_CMD_FAT
> +
> +#ifdef CONFIG_USB_KEYBOARD
> +#define CONFIG_SYS_USB_EVENT_POLL
> +#define CONFIG_PREBOOT "usb start"
> +#endif /* CONFIG_USB_KEYBOARD */
> +
> +#endif /* CONFIG_MUSB_HCD */
> +
> +#ifdef CONFIG_MUSB_UDC
> +/* USB device configuration */
> +#define CONFIG_USB_DEVICE		1
> +#define CONFIG_USB_TTY			1
> +#define CONFIG_SYS_CONSOLE_IS_IN_ENV	1
> +/* Change these to suit your needs */
> +#define CONFIG_USBD_VENDORID		0x0451
> +#define CONFIG_USBD_PRODUCTID		0x5678
> +#define CONFIG_USBD_MANUFACTURER	"Texas Instruments"
> +#define CONFIG_USBD_PRODUCT_NAME	"EVM"
> +#endif /* CONFIG_MUSB_UDC */
> +
> +#endif /* CONFIG_USB_OMAP3 */
> +
>  /* commands to include */
>  #include <config_cmd_default.h>
>  
> @@ -159,6 +197,7 @@
>  
>  #define CONFIG_EXTRA_ENV_SETTINGS \
>  	"loadaddr=0x82000000\0" \
> +	"usbtty=cdc_acm\0" \
>  	"console=ttyS2,115200n8\0" \
>  	"mmcargs=setenv bootargs console=${console} " \
>  		"root=/dev/mmcblk0p2 rw " \
